



A BAND WITH A DIRECTION
Most eternity rings have no orientation. A circle of round stones reads the same clockwise or anticlockwise, and there is no way to wear it wrong. A band of pears does not work like that. Every stone has a point and a shoulder, so the whole ring runs one way, and it looks different depending on which way round it sits on the hand.
The Gaby commits to that with twenty-four pear cuts at 4.00 × 2.50 mm, 2.22 carats in total, every one facing the same direction around the circumference. A single stone rotated against the flow is not a subtle flaw. It is the one the eye goes to.
THE SETTING
Each pear sits in its own collet. At this size the point of the stone measures a fraction of a millimetre, and it is both the most fragile part of the diamond and the part the collar has to close around most precisely. Too little metal and the tip is exposed to the first knock; too much and the collar creeps onto the table where it can be seen.
Twenty-four collars, each cut to follow a curve that tapers to that point, at a scale where the margin for error is smaller than the feature being protected.

Because the diamonds encircle the entire band, an eternity ring cannot be resized once it has been produced. Please size carefully before ordering.
